A colourless, odourless oily liquid consisting of a mixture of hydrocarbons obtained from petroleum, used as a laxative. Liquid paraffin, also known as paraffinum liquidum or Russian mineral oil, is a very highly refined mineral oil used in cosmetics and medicine.
